STEMI: thrombus is the problem

Session comprising selected EuroPCR 2024 Clinical Case submissions

Summary

This session will feature a series of selected clinical case submissions from EuroPCR 2024, focusing on the management of STEMI patients with a high thrombotic burden. Attendees will have the opportunity to explore various strategies and techniques, such as the use of pharmacomechanical thromboaspiration, prevention of thrombus embolization, and the treatment of no-reflow in acute coronary syndromes. The session will provide valuable insights and practical tips for navigating these challenging STEMI scenarios.
